The increasing annual cost (including tuition, room, board, books and fees) to attend college ) to attend college has been widely discussed in many publications including Money magazine. The following random samples show the annual cost of attending private and public colleges. Data are in thousands of dollars. Click on the datafile logo to reference the data. Round degrees of freedom to the preceding whole number. DATA file Private Colleges 52.8 43.2 45.0 33.3 44.0 30.6 45.8 37.8 50.5 42.0 Public Colleges 20.3 22.0 28.2 15.6 24.1 28.5 22.8 25.8 18.5 25.6 14.4 21.8 a. Compute the sample mean and sample standard deviation for private and public colleges. Round your answers to two decimal places. T2 = Si = S2 = b. What is the point estimate of the difference between the two population means? Round your answer to one decimal place. Interpret this value in terms of the annual cost of attending private and public colleges. $ c. Develop a 95% confidence interval of the difference between the mean annual cost of attending private and public colleges. 95% confidence interval, private colleges have a population mean annual cost $ to $ more expensive than public colleges.
